Top Banner
Модель
29

5 даталогич модельбд

Apr 13, 2017

Download

Education

Welcome message from author
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Page 1: 5 даталогич модельбд

Модель

Page 2: 5 даталогич модельбд
Page 3: 5 даталогич модельбд
Page 4: 5 даталогич модельбд
Page 5: 5 даталогич модельбд
Page 6: 5 даталогич модельбд

Какие модели объектов ты знаешь? Приведи примеры их использования.

Page 7: 5 даталогич модельбд
Page 8: 5 даталогич модельбд

Какие свойства объекта – оригинала отражаются в модели?

Page 9: 5 даталогич модельбд

Что ты должен знать?Обладает ли знаковая модель( текст, число) свойством внешней схожести с объектом-

оригиналом?Земля - это третья от Солнца планета Солнечной системы. Она обращается вокруг звезды по эллиптической орбите (очень близкой к круговой) со средней скоростью 29.765 км/с, на среднем расстоянии 149.6 млн. км за период равный 365.24 суток.

Page 10: 5 даталогич модельбд

Описание отношений между понятиями в виде текста – это

текстовая модель.

Прочитай и запомни: Изображение отношений между

понятиями на рисунке, схеме или фотографии – это графическая модель.

Каждая роза есть цветок, но не всякий цветок есть

роза.Цветок

роза

Page 11: 5 даталогич модельбд

Текстовая модель Графическая модель

- это суждение, описывающее

отношения между понятиями

- это схема или чертеж,

отражающие отношения между

понятиями

Способы описания отношений между

понятиями

Page 12: 5 даталогич модельбд
Page 13: 5 даталогич модельбд
Page 14: 5 даталогич модельбд
Page 15: 5 даталогич модельбд
Page 16: 5 даталогич модельбд

Модели данных даталогического

уровня

Page 17: 5 даталогич модельбд

• Информационная модель — модель предметной области, отражающая ее информационные аспекты.

Page 18: 5 даталогич модельбд

Инфологическая модель (информационно-логическая модель) — ориентированная на человека и не зависимая от типа СУБД модель предметной области, определяющая совокупности информационных объектов, их атрибутов и отношений между объектами, динамику изменений предметной области, а также характер информационных потребностей пользователей. Инфологическая модель предметной области может быть описана моделью "сущность—связь" (моделью Чена), в основе которой лежит деление реального мира на отдельные различимые сущности, находящиеся в определенных связях друг с другом.

Page 19: 5 даталогич модельбд
Page 20: 5 даталогич модельбд

Так как доступ к данным осуществляется с помощью конкретной СУБД, то модели должны быть представлены на языке описания данных этой СУБД. Такое описание, создаваемое по инфологической модели данных, называют даталогической моделью данных.

Даталогические модели — модели данных, ориентированные на выбранный тип СУБД: внутренняя, концептуальная, внешняя.

Page 21: 5 даталогич модельбд

Внутренняя модель — модель данных низшего (физического) уровня в архитектуре СУБД, отражающая представление данных во внешней памяти и методы доступа к ним.Внешняя модель — модель данных внешнего уровня в архитектуре СУБД, отражающая представление пользователя о базе данных (подсхема базы данных и ее описание).

Page 22: 5 даталогич модельбд

Концептуальная модель — информационная модель предметной области в терминах конкретной СУБД, содержащая полный набор данных и связей между ними. В архитектуре СУБД представляет промежуточный между внешним и внутренним уровень.

Схема базы данных — описание даталогических моделей в терминах СУБД (часто используется как синоним модели данных).

Page 23: 5 даталогич модельбд

Исходные данные для даталогического проектирования

Исходные документы;Понятия;Объекты;ЯвленияДанные о предметной области.

Page 24: 5 даталогич модельбд

Результат даталогического проектирования

Конечным результатом даталогического проектирования является' описание логической структуры БД на языке описания данных.

Если проектирование выполняется «вручную», то для большей наглядности сначала строится схематическое графическое изображение структуры БД. При этом должно быть обеспечено однозначное соответствие между конструкциями языка описания данных и графическими обозначениями информационных единиц и связей между ними.

Page 25: 5 даталогич модельбд

Проектирование логической структуры предполагает: • разбиение всей информации по отношениям (таблицам); • определение состава полей (атрибутов) каждого отношения; • определение ключа каждого отношения; • определение связей и обеспечение целостности по связям.

Page 26: 5 даталогич модельбд
Page 27: 5 даталогич модельбд
Page 28: 5 даталогич модельбд

•Разработайте информационно-логическую модель БД информационной системы контроля за ходом выполнения учебного процесса в вузе. В БД должны хранится сведения о:

•преподавателях, работающих на кафедрах факультетов;•студентах, обучаемых в составе учебных групп;•учебных группах;•изучаемых дисциплинах;•распределение преподавателей по дисциплинам;•результатах обучения.

Задание №1

Page 29: 5 даталогич модельбд

•Предметная область ИС: Библиотека

•Предметная область ИС: Авторемонтные мастерские

•Предметная область ИС: Поликлиника

Задание №2

Задание №3

Задание №4